Job description

EV CARGOhave grown to become a predominate international supply chain partner to many of the world’s leading brands. We enable customer success through market leading air, ocean, surface freight, logistics, supply chain and technology solutions. Our growth is accelerating around the world.

Key Responsibilities

As a Warehouse Operative, you will:

  • Load and Unload Vehicles: Efficiently manage the loading and unloading of goods.
  • Stock Management: Accurately check and book stock in and out, ensuring compliance with company procedures and standards.
  • Operate Machinery: Safely and competently use mechanical handling equipment and safety devices in line with company protocols and HSE guidelines.
  • Safety Checks: Conduct safety inspections on forklift trucks and batteries, promptly reporting defects to the Warehouse Supervisor.
  • Pick & Pack: Handle picking and packing operations with accuracy and efficiency.

Our Ideal Candidate Will Have Essential Skills

  • Valid Counterbalance Licence and Forklift Licence.
  • Awareness of workplace hazards and safety protocols.
  • Proficient in using computers and relevant systems.

Experience

  • A minimum of 2+ years of relevant experience in warehouse operations.
  • Proven ability to adapt to a rapidly growing and dynamic environment.
  • Strong communication and influencing skills across all organisational levels.
